Abstract

Selected results of investigations focused on the changes to some mechanical properties of palladium and several palladium-based alloys caused by exposure to hydrogen have been collected and presented. The findings indicate that the mechanical properties of pure palladium are highly susceptible to alteration upon exposure to hydrogen. In the cases of alloying palladium with silver and copper, the alloys, as compared to palladium, appear to resist changes to mechanical properties. In the case of alloying palladium with manganese, the interesting order–disorder phenomenon plays an important role on the effects of hydrogen exposure on their mechanical properties.
